Analysis

Analysis

Analysis of information exchange and communication processes between ECUs and software functions.

The aim of the analysis is to evaluate information exchanged between ECUs and software functions. The information exchange can be realized via networking technologies (bus systems, networks) or via hardware connections (digital/analog).

The level of detail ranges from physical values (current, voltage, etc.) to digitized binary information on protocol packets to signals represented symbolically, which can be displayed in CANalyzer with the help of various analysis windows.

Diagnostics

Diagnostics

Detailed analysis of automotive ECU diagnostic communication

CANalyzer supports all relevant automotive networks and transport protocols.

You can perform diagnostic tests semi-automated as well as interactively. For interactive tests, a diagnostic window is available for all important use cases, e.g. read fault memory, variant coding, OBD-II.

Key Feature: Analysis Despite of Security

Analyzing of Security-Protected ECUs and Networks with Security Manager

Analyzing of Security-Protected ECUs and Networks with Security Manager

Security mechanisms in the ECU secure the vehicle and its functions against manipulation and unauthorized access. However, for analyzing and diagnostic purposes, it must be possible for an authorized individual to participate in vehicle communication during development and later operation.

With the Security Manager, Vector offers a uniform solution that is used identically for many Vector tools. In addition to CANalyzer also CANoe, CANape, Indigo, CANoe.DiVa, and vFlash use the Security Manager.

Use Cases of the Security Manager

  • Communication: SecOC − with only a focus on analysis
  • Diagnostics: Authentication
  • Diagnostics: Variant Coding
  • TLS: Simulation of Client and Server
  • TLS: TLS Observer using Master Secret
  • TLS: DoIP over TLS
  • MACsec: Standard 802.1 AE 2018
  • MACsec: Key Agreement (MKA)-Protokoll 802.1.x-2020
  • IPsec: IKEv2 support for certificate based peer authentication, dead peer detection, IKE fragmentation and IKE rekeying
  • IPsec: Import of StrongSwan IPsec configurations
  • IPsec: Full control of the Security Policy Database

CANalyzer Variants

... are staggered feature sets of an Edition. They are compiled appropriately for the respective application.

Expert Variant (/exp)

The expert variant is ideal for all standard applications. It provides nearly all functions and extensions without limitation. 
However, creating and executing CAPL programs is not supported in this this variant. 

Expert Variant (/exp)

Professional Variant (/pro)

The professional variant provides all functions and extensions without limitations. It supports all use cases from simple observation of the network traffic to complex analysis, stimulation and testing of heterogeneous systems.
